Bridgetown Audio Podcast is the sermon podcast of Bridgetown Church in Portland, Oregon. It features teachings from the church's services, aiming to bring a piece of Portland's faith community to listeners anywhere. The podcast is described with the motto 'In Portland as it is in Heaven.' All teachings are available to stream and download via the church's website, bridgetown.church.
